In this talk Dr. Michael Kinsey from Arup Fire (China) presents an overview of research conducted looking at cognitive biases within decision making during fire evacuations. The talk includes a broad description of decision making theory along how cognitive biases can influence this. A review is then presented which links cognitive biases to known and expected behaviors people exhibit during fire evacuations. Methods for considering how cognitive biases may be mitigated during fire evacuations is then discussed along with how fire engineers may encounter cognitive biases throughout their general work.
